Subject: Cron-to-Flowhart cut-over complete

Team, as of Tuesday night all fourteen scheduled jobs on the Pellwick billing stack have been migrated from host-level cron to the Flowhart workflow engine. Each job now has explicit retry policies, dependency ordering, and alerting through Quillbeam. We ran both systems in parallel for five days and diffed outputs; no discrepancies. The legacy crontabs are disabled but archived for thirty days. For reference at the sync, here are the current Flowhart runtime settings.

deployment values, yafop-tahof:
HOLIX_HOST=holix.zemvarsys.internal
HOLIX_PORT=3306

## Releases

Heads up, support folks: starting with PixelWash 4.2, every uploaded image gets its EXIF data scrubbed automatically before it hits storage. That means no GPS coordinates, camera serials, or timestamps sneaking through. If a customer asks why their photo metadata vanished, that's why — it's a feature, not a bug. Release builds are produced by the Quillford pipeline and signed before publishing. To verify a release bundle came from us, check it against the key below.

signing key of tafop-yaduf = bky4_uj3Z

Subject: Ormwell cut-over — done, mostly painless

Hi — quick wrap-up for your review. We finished swapping the legacy ORM layer for the new Ormwell adapter on Friday night. Query logging is now centralized and raw SQL escape hatches are gone, which should simplify your audit. One rollback early on due to a stale connection pool, resolved since. For completeness, the live adapter settings are pasted below.

settings of fafog-haduf:
ZORIX_PIN=4648
ZORIX_METRICS_HOST=metrics.zorix.paliqsys.corp
ZORIX_LOG_LEVEL=info
ZORIX_TENANT=druix